<title>Expressing support for policies that maintain a robust Veterans Health Administration of the Department of Veterans Affairs and do not jeopardize care for veterans by moving essential resources to the private sector.</title>

<summary-text><![CDATA[<p>Declares that the House of Representatives:</p> <ul> <li>supports policies that provide necessary resources to serve veterans by maintaining a robust Veterans Health Administration (VHA); </li> <li> opposes policies that would jeopardize care for veterans by moving essential resources away from the VHA and into the private sector; and </li> <li> supports policies that would create integrated health care networks for veterans, with the VHA serving as the coordinator and primary provider of care and selected high-quality community partners providing care as needed to ensure timely and convenient access for enrolled veterans.</li> </ul>]]></summary-text>

<dc:description>This file contains bill summaries for federal legislation. A bill summary describes the most significant provisions of a piece of legislation and details the effects the legislative text may have on current law and federal programs. Bill summaries are authored by the Congressional Research Service (CRS) of the Library of Congress. As stated in Public Law 91-510 (2 USC 166 (d)(6)), one of the duties of CRS is "to prepare summaries and digests of bills and resolutions of a public general nature introduced in the Senate or House of Representatives".
